Ultra Intelligence & Communications is looking for a qualified candidate to lead engineering projects in Maidenhead, UK. The role demands exemplary engineering management and technical leadership skills, overseeing a multi-discipline team to meet project objectives on time and budget.

Candidates should demonstrate extensive knowledge of Systems Engineering and the ability to engage with numerous stakeholders.

We offer 25 days of annual leave, a pension contribution, and a variety of flexible benefits to support our team's wellbeing.
